Default XL2003 Destination and Source Open but not updating

Hi,

I recently migrated to 2003 and when using a file created in 2000/2002 the
links
do not update when the Source file is open. First, I opent the destination
workbook, choose not to update links, open the source workbook and make
changes. The changes are not updated in the destination workbook.

If I edit the equation in the destination workbook by deleting the path
('\\server\folder\[filename]sheet'!cellref) up to the filename of the source,
then the values update. Once I close the source, the equation in the
destination changes to a mapped drive type path
('S:\folder\[filename]sheet'!cellref).

Why are the links not updating when the source is open, and why is the path
changing from \\server style to mapped drive style?

Just a guess....

I'd try this:

Tools|options|General Tab|Web Options Button|Files Tab
Uncheck Update links on save.

to see if it stopped the conversion of UNC names to mapped drives.
